Introduces new module that provides network-related features for
the StrictMode developer API. The first feature offers to detect
sockets sending data not wrapped inside a layer of SSL/TLS
encryption.
When a developer enables, we ask netd to watch all outgoing traffic
from our UID, and penalize us accordingly if cleartext sockets are
detected. When enabled, netd captures the offending packet and
passes it back to the owning process to aid investigations. When
death penalty is requested, all future traffic on the socket is
blocked, which usually results in a useful stacktrace before the
app is actually killed.

If the manifest doesn't specify large heaps, we now call
VMRuntime.clampGrowthLimit to release heap virtual address space
which won't ever get used.

Symptom:
Assume a foreground broadcast FG and a background BG.
If a recevier registers both FG and BG. When sending
BG and FG to the receiver, and the receiver BG receiver
completes first, its finishReceiver will trigger next FG
receiver rather than BG, and also deliver wrong result
code/data to the next.
More detail and sample:
https://code.google.com/p/android/issues/detail?id=92917
Root cause:
Due to BroadcastQueue:getMatchingOrderedReceiver will match
by receiver(IBinder), so the caller ActivityManagerService:
broadcastRecordForReceiverLocked will always match the first
queue(fg) if a receiver is both receiving fg and bg.
Solution:
Add a parameter flags to finishReceiver, then server side
could know the finished receiver should belong to which queue.

There is a NullPointerException in `handleHorizontalFocusWithinListItem()`
because `selectedView.findFocus()` returns null and then there is no null
check when when the assigned variable `currentFocus` is used, although
`View.findFocus()` states that it may return null.
